>> Subject: [PATCH] brcmfmac: avoid duplicated suspend/resume operation
>>
>> WiFi chip has 2 SDIO functions, and PM core will trigger
>> twice suspend/resume operations for one WiFi chip to do
>> the same things. This patch avoid this case.
